Dr. KamirΓ£ Barbosa Ribeiro, Universidade de BrasΓ­lia (UnB), Brazil.

Dr. KamirΓ£ Barbosa Ribeiro is a dedicated civil engineer and researcher specializing in structural analysis and engineering materials. She holds a Master’s degree in Structures and Civil Construction from the University of BrasΓ­lia, where she focused on the experimental analysis of precast sandwich panels under axial load. Her academic journey is enriched by various honors, publications, and participation in prestigious conferences. KamirΓ£’s passion for innovation in civil engineering drives her contributions to both academia and the broader engineering community. πŸŒπŸ”§πŸ“š

Dr. Lee Ho Joon ,Cheongju University, South Korea.

Dr. Lee Ho JoonΒ  is an accomplished assistant professor in Electrical Engineering at Cheongju University, South Korea, specializing in electric equipment design and control. He holds a Doctorate from Hanyang University, where he developed innovative technologies in motors and drive systems. With numerous publications in renowned journals and patents, Dr. Lee actively participates in various research projects funded by the Ministry of Trade, Industry, and Energy. He has received several awards, including the Emerging Researcher Award in the Information and Control Division. His contributions to eco-friendly technologies in construction equipment and electric vehicles position him as a leader in his field.Β βš‘πŸ”§
